The Importance of Mobile CRM Solutions in Boosting Business Efficiency

In today’s fast-paced business environment, effective communication and collaboration are key factors to achieve success. Customer Relationship Management (CRM) systems enable businesses to manage customer interactions, streamline operations, and improve efficiency. An effective CRM system should be accessible to employees no matter their location or device. Benefits of Same Functionality on Mobile Devices and Computers

Having mobile CRM solutions with the same features and functionality as desktop versions offers numerous benefits for businesses. With the widespread use of smartphones and tablets, employees can access the CRM system anywhere and anytime, providing them with flexibility, mobility, and ease of use. This accessibility ensures that employees can work remotely and efficiently, boosting overall productivity.

Overview of Mobile CRM Software

Mobile CRM software is designed for mobile devices such as tablets and smartphones. These applications enable remote access to customer data and processes, which can help improve customer service, sales, and marketing. Most mobile CRM solutions have corresponding desktop versions as well, which allows for seamless collaboration between teams.

Prioritizing Needs for CRM Implementation

When implementing a CRM system, it is essential to prioritize your needs, including offline needs, team requirements, technology, and growth goals. This ensures that you choose a CRM solution that aligns with your business goals while providing a better understanding of the support the CRM system requires from the team.

Access and Use of CRM Software Through Mobile Devices

With mobile CRM solutions, sales, customer service, and marketing teams can access CRM software and data wherever and whenever they need it. This quick and easy access to real-time information enables employees to offer timely and personalized customer service, improves communication with customers, and enhances collaboration among team members.

Forecasts for Mobile CRM Market Growth

According to research by Market.us, the mobile CRM market is expected to grow at a CAGR of 13% by 2029. This growth is driven by the increasing need for mobility and seamless customer interactions, which can help enhance the overall customer experience.

Real-world challenges and the need for flexibility

While mobile CRM solutions offer many benefits, they also have their limitations. In some remote or rural areas, internet access may be weak or non-existent, which can affect the real-time collaboration of team members. Therefore, flexibility is essential when selecting a mobile CRM solution that supports consistent mobile work regardless of network availability.:
